Microfinance Loans
Small loans provided to individuals or groups in impoverished areas, intended to spur entrepreneurship and alleviate poverty.
Traditional Bank Loans
Traditional bank loans refer to fixed amounts of money borrowed from banks, with specified repayment terms, including interest, over a set period.
Collateral
An asset that a borrower offers to a lender as security for a loan, which can be seized if the borrower fails to repay.
Building Infrastructure
The process of constructing physical and organizational structures and facilities needed for the operation of a society or enterprise.
